1974 Complete restoration
-New paint with undercoating. $5000 plus in paint alone.
-5 lug conversion with 911 front struts and calipers. Rebuilt rear calipers (Auto Atlanta) w/new 916 rotors
-New tires with recent alignment
-Completely new LEATHER interior (seats, back pad, door panels, dash) with HEATED SEATS. $3000 invested.
-All new seals and bearings, including new German single piece front seat for door and top.
-Transmission completely gone through and rebuilt~ no grinding at all, not even downshifting into first at slow speeds prior to stopping.
-FAT PERFORMANCE engine.
All parts from FAT PERFORMANCE with assembly completed by Abacus Racing in Virginia Beach VA.
Original engine was torn down and sent to CA. Case clearanced, heads completely rebuilt (new springs, valves, seats, etc), ALL new parts. Only 1500 miles on complete rebuild. Carbs rejeted for motor, oil changed at 1000 miles and again with carb adjustment. Compression checked. 2374cc w/approximately 150 horsepower. 96mm pistons w/82mm stroker crank. $7000 in parts alone~ car pulls solidly in all gears through 7000 RPM.
-All engine sheet metal blasted and powdered coated black
-Inside of engine compartment treated
-Fuel tank cleaned and treated on inside, powdercoated on outside w/new fuel tank sender
-New accelerator cable
-New battery
-New high torque starter
-Stainless steel heat exchangers
-New muffler
-New 140lb springs
-All new brake lines and new 19mm master cylinder. Parking brake is properly adjusted and solid
-New shocks and struts
-New struts for rear trunk lid to replace old springs
-All lights work and the turn signal actually clicks back automatically after a turn.
-Current VA inspection good through Sept of 2010. Clear title. I still have some of the original paperwork from the car.
-ALL Receipts for work completed
-Pics don't show 914 2.0 insignia on rear but it's now there

No radio, no backpad light, trunk light, or coat hooks but everything else is there. As you can see from the pics the steering wheel is original~ horn works!

Beautiful car, good luck with the sale. One question I have: with your 5 lug conversion, do you have an emergency brake? If so, how was it done?

I do have an emergency brake. I kept the stock 914 rear calipers and had them rebuilt by Automobile Atlanta. I put on new 916 rear rotors which are five lug and had the original hubs drilled to accept the five bolt pattern. So, it kept the original calipers and the original parking brake~ which is adjusted and holds great. The front has the complete 911 front suspension with the vented rotors. Car brakes really well which is nice. Thanks... Kevin
